‘It’s even prettier than me’ – Cristiano Ronaldo pleased with statue of himself
Larger-than-life bronze statue mocked online
Who says he's vain? Cristiano Ronaldo was happy to take second billing as he unveiled a giant statue - of himself - on his home island of Madeira in Portugal.
Ronaldo calls the larger-than-life bronze statue “prettier than me,” according to Spanish news agency Europa Press.
But the statue immediately drew gags on social media for its rather prominent bulge in the shorts area.
The 29-year-old Real Madrid forward helped the Spanish team win the Club World Cup in Morocco on Saturday.
Ronaldo already has a museum dedicated to his career on Madeira.
He says “I never expected to have a statue in my life.”
